
Management of Access Bank (Ghana) Plc has announced the
appointment of Mr. Olumide Olatunji as its new Managing Director, effective
December 5, 2018.
He replaces Mr. Ifeanyi Njoku, who has now taken up a new
role within the Access Bank Group to support the Bank’s expansion drive in line
with its new five-year strategic growth plan.
Ghana News Agency reported that Nana Adu Kyeremateng, Head of
Corporate Communications – Access Bank Ghana said Olatunji’s appointment
followed the approval of the Bank of Ghana.
With 20years experience in banking, Olatunji is believed to
have what it takes to drive the bank’s corporate strategy of becoming one of
Ghana’s leading Banks by 2022.
Mr. Olatunji had led the bank’s entire commercial Banking
business in Lagos, Nigeria where he provided strong leadership in building and
overseeing key strategic relationships for business success and growth.
He had also served as a Subsidiary Director of Access Bank in
Rwanda and the Democratic Republic of Congo.
The Board Chairman of Access Bank (Ghana), Mr. Frank Beecham
congratulated Olatunji on his new appointment.
Mr. Beecham thanked Mr. Njoku for his tenure as Managing
Director.
Mr. Olatunji thanked the Board and other stakeholders of the Bank.
